About the role

The Payroll Compliance Officer is responsible for monitoring and auditing payroll processes to ensure compliance with relevant awards and policies. You will collaborate with the Payroll Team Leaders and the Group Payroll Manager to implement best practices, manage compliance risks, and contribute to continuous improvement initiatives within the payroll function.

Key Responsibilities 

  • Conduct audits, monitor payroll activities, and ensure compliance with awards, enterprise agreements, legislation and policies.
  • Lead risk management initiatives, identifying potential compliance risks and recommending mitigation strategies.
  • Collaborate with payroll teams to enhance processes and maintain accurate application of payroll practices.
  • Develop and update payroll policies to reflect legal changes and best practices.
